Marchoi Valley trek:

Marchoi valley is a rare trek in Kashmir which is also possible during winters. Kashmir doesn’t need an introduction for its unparalleled beauty, wide valleys, lush green meadows, abundance of wild flowers and gushing streams in summers, autumn foliages or be its snow covered landscapes and forests during winters. It has at least something unique and beautiful in each season.

Essentially the trail is a river valley and we approach it from Naranag, a village which is around 2 hours drive from Srinagar. Naranag has archaeological importance and is an old Hindu pilgrimage site with ruins of Temple complex. Lalitaditya Muktapida built these temples during the rule of Karkota Dynasty.

The trail from Naranag is initially gentle along the river so that you can reach Dumail comfortably in 2 hours or so. We cover wonderful stretches of pine and maple forests to reach silver fir and birch tree covered Dumail grazing area.

This trail is meant such that we can camp at Dumail for 3 nights and explore two sides from this camp. One being the Marchoi valley and the other one is the Shadimarg area.

Brief Itinerary:

Day 1: Start from Srinagar/airport latest by 10 am and drive to Naranag (~ 2440 m/8000 ft) – 60/70 Km – 3 hours. – Trek from Naranag village to Dumail – 4 Km – 2/3 hours. Camp.
Day 2: Trek from Dumail to Marchoi Valley via Shingdi and back to Dumail (6 hrs) – ~ 5 Km – Camp.
Day 3: Trek to Shadimarg top and back to Dumail camp – 6/7 hours –  ~ 5 Km. Camp.
Day 4: Trek from Dumail to Naranag -2 hours – 4 Km – Visit the ancient ruins/complex and then drive back to Srinagar – 60 Km  – 2 hours.

Why Marchoi trek as a snow trek in winter or spring?

It is not easy to find a winter trek in Kashmir as the region gets the most snowfall out of the Indian Himalayan region. However Marchoi valley is possible to reach during winters and explore the surroundings depending on the snow conditions.

It is true that the trail in Kashmir blooms and streams rush throughout summers and make this valley green and vibrant. But hardly we have seen Kashmir winters apart from a very few popular destinations/ski resorts. Other popular Kashmir treks are on high altitude and remain inaccessible between the months of October to June. Marchoi valley trek during winters and spring is a rare opportunity to snowy wonderland and often resembling snowy Alps mountains.

Marchoi valley trek seasons and best time to visit:

This low altitude trail is  ideally a year around trek. Either you may like to walk on snow or when the valleys are green and verdant.

Winters and Spring: December to May for snow trek

Summer trek: June to September

temperature and clothing for Marchoi valley trek:

It is important to carry proper clothing in this trek. We recommend to use “three layers” of clothing  in the campsite during early morning or evening, while you are outside tent.

  1. A quick dry base layer (Dry-fit t-shirt).
  2. A warm jacket (Double layer or Fleece jacket ) as middle layer.
  3. A windproof cum waterproof with hood as the outer layer.
  4. Additionally you would require a rucksack and a decent trekking shoe.

How to reach trek basecamp (Naranag):

Our trek basecamp Naranag is an offbeat tourist destination in the Ganderbal district of Kashmir. It takes between 2 to 3 hours to reach Naranag from Srinagar/Airport covering some 60 to 70 Km distance. Trek’s end point is also Naranag. Getting to Naranag (The trek base):

We will arrange a car pickup from Srinagar to Naranag and return. This will be shared equally by the availing team members.

The best option to reach Srinagar is by flight. There are direct flights from Delhi and other major cities.

By train one has to reach Jammu and then a drive to Srinagar, which takes around 12 hours covering approximately 300 Km.
